Vine pruning is a crucial practice for maintaining healthy development, controlling size, and boosting fruit or flower production. Routine pruning gets rid of dead, harmed, or overcrowded stems, which improves air flow, light penetration, and minimizes the risk of disease. Appropriate timing and strategy depend upon the kind of vine, its development routine, and the desired result, whether for ornamental purposes or fruit production. Techniques such as heading cuts, thinning cuts, and training along trellises or supports guide the plant's growth and enhance structural strength. Pruning also motivates vigorous brand-new shoots and flowering, while keeping vines from ending up being invasive or thick. A consistent pruning schedule promotes long-lasting health and visual appeal, making sure vines stay appealing and productive. Correct vine management contributes to general landscape looks and boosts the functionality of garden functions such as arbors, pergolas, and fences
